u/planery133 21d ago edited 21d ago

Just ran a test on my current modlist. Built around Rudy CW Edit preset, heavy complex material usage. Removed ENB, installed CS+upscaling+skylighting and started a test on a new save.

Upscaling is definitely doing some heavy lifting. When on DLAA (which I also use with ENB), I honestly don't see that much of performance gain, sometimes 7-8 fps, sometimes the same. Honestly I don't expect heavily modded Skyrim to pull a 4k60 consistently anytime soon.

Getting rid of light limits is a very welcoming change to have. In a few places in my load order if I turn on candle light it will go over the limit. I am too lazy to hunt and split those meshes, so an automatic solution is welcomed.

Also, do not expect everything to look the same. Mine is noticeably darker indoors and outdoors after switching to CS, and many of the lighting effect are more muted (e.g. water reflection of magelight at night), though I suspect these can be changed through config tweaking.

9

u/AlexKwiatek 21d ago

Its essentially a big project that adds graphical effects and fix graphical bugs. It already added Upscaling, Framegen, fixed long considered unfixable bug with light limit on a single mesh, added wetness effects, global illumination, grass collision. All sorts of stuff. Think about ENB but actually done deeper within the engine, not as a wrapper.

They currently work on stuff like shadow limit fix and switching to vulkan/dx12 that would allow for utilising more than 1 CPU thread. This would potentially add 50% more frames which is wild.

4

u/hazy-morning 20d ago

I was getting about 10 frames more with CS with the enb preset over ENB series. CS: 80-100fps in whiterun tundra, freaks floral fields, ultrawide 1440p ENB: 80-90fps

With CS I'm able to use upscaling and frame generation, which increased my fps to my max (144)

I really like the rain effects. There are some visual bug I'm seeing with fire (i.e. braizers and torches) but it's not horrible. I'm going to stick with it and try out some PBR textures!

I haven't done much to test this, just uninstalled kiloader, removed enb files, etc
